摘要
针对棉织物传统冷堆漂白工艺中双氧水无效分解过多、织物强力损伤较大等问题,研究了一种新型复合冷堆氧漂体系。确定的优化漂白工艺为:30%H2O2105 g/L,NaOH 20 g/L,低温催化剂EA 10 g/L,协同增效剂MS-310 g/L,复合氧漂稳定剂T130740 g/L,渗透剂D-5215 g/L,25℃堆置24 h。结果表明,新型冷堆漂白织物具有低强力损伤、高白度和良好的润湿性能,白度可达80.75,断裂强力损伤仅3.72%,各项性能均优于传统冷堆漂白织物。
In view of the problems of excessive decomposition of hydrogen peroxide and great strength dam⁃age of fabric in traditional cold batch bleaching process of cotton fabric,a new compound oxygen bleaching sys⁃tem is developed.The optimized bleaching process is 30%H2O2105 g/L,NaOH 20 g/L,low temperature catalyst EA 10 g/L,synergist MS-310 g/L,compound oxygen bleaching stabilizer T130740 g/L,penetrant D-5215 g/L,batching up at 25℃ for 24 h.The results show that the fabric pretreated with new cold batch bleaching pro⁃cess has lower strength damage,higher whiteness and good wetting performance,with the whiteness up to 80.75 and only 3.72%of the breaking strength damage.All the properties of the fabric with new process are bet⁃ter than those with the traditional process.
